Zotac Unveils GeForce 9800 GTX Graphics Card

Techtree News Staff, Jun 13, 2008 1218 hrs IST

The new graphic card delivers the power of Nvidia GeForce 9 series graphics and features a custom self-contained water-cooling system requires no end-user maintenance

Zotac has unveiled a new GPU graphics card, dubbed the GeForce 9800 GTX ZONE Edition, which delivers the power of Nvidia GeForce 9 series graphics with PureVideo HD video processing technology in a virtually silent graphics card.

Cooled by a custom water-cooling system, the new graphic card promises to deliver high-performance in DirectX 10 and OpenGL 2.1 titles while keeping thermal and noise levels to a minimum. And unlike conventional water-cooling units available from third parties, this self-contained water-cooling system requires no end-user maintenance. The cooling system is already attached to the card and only requires the user to mount the 120mm fan and radiator module. The company claims that this cooling system delivers up to 21.5% lower GPU temperatures compared to traditional air-cooled solutions.

In addition to the water-cooler, the card also claims to offer a slight performance boost through higher clock speeds. According to the company, the new graphic card raises core, shader and memory clock speeds to 700 MHz, 1700 MHz and 2250 MHz, respectively. It comes equipped with 512MB of GDDR3 memory.

The new graphic card is compatible with Microsoft DirectX 10 and OpenGL 2.1 to offer fast frame rates in the latest 3D games and applications. The graphic card also features Nvidia Unified Architecture, HybridPower, 3-way SLI, GigaThread, Quantum Effects, second-generation PureVideo HD and PCI Express 2.0 interface.

The Zotac GeForce 9800 GTX ZONE Edition graphic card is priced at Rs 22,700.
